Wild West World is the second area of DK: King of Swing. Both Donkey Kong and Diddy Kong were playable in the area. It contained five levels: "Necky's Canyon", "Cactus Woods", "Treacherous Twister", "Madcap Mine" and "Fire Necky's Nest" where the boss of the area, Fire Necky can be fought.
